Ahmedabad continues to offer some of the most affordable housing options among India’s major cities, and the sub-₹50 lakh segment remains active with a range of genuine options for first-time buyers and investors with moderate budgets. The North Ahmedabad belt — comprising Chandkheda, Tragad, Ranip, and Nikol — is where the highest density of sub-₹50 lakh projects exist. These areas have seen significant
infrastructure improvement and offer good connectivity to industrial and commercial zones, making them popular with young working professionals.
South and South-West Ahmedabad, including areas like Vatva, Odhav, and Narol, offer 1 BHK and compact 2 BHK units well within this budget. While these areas are more industrial in character, improved road networks and BRTS connectivity have made daily commuting easier. Sanand, along the western industrial corridor, is an emerging affordable residential market with several RERA-registered projects offering 2 BHK apartments in the ₹35–48 lakh range. Proximity to manufacturing employment hubs ensures healthy rental demand.
When evaluating affordable projects, check whether the price includes parking, whether the developer is PMAY-approved (which may entitle you to interest subsidies under the credit-linked subsidy scheme), and what the maintenance charges are post-possession. Avoid projects where pricing seems unusually low compared to comparable developments in the same area — this often signals compromised construction quality, pending approvals, or unapproved layouts.
